I-F-A alliance??
what do you all think of an alliance between italy, france and austria??
austria and italy probably has to face a juggernaut and france has to face germany...
steephie22 (182 D(S))
12 Feb 11 UTC
well, tell me what you think...
i think it could be a really powerful alliance that can beat the other 4 countries if they aren't all working together...
if they are all attacking 1 of those 3 countries russia wins, but if england, germany or turkey is attacking russia the alliance will win...
there is only a problem if england and germany work together against france and russia and turkey form a juggernaut...
but in that case france is down and england and germany should face the juggernaut...
i think it could be a very powerful opening for austria that has to face a juggernaut most of time, for italy who is in a defensive position and can't advance much on france or austria and now can move and convoy to everywhere on the world and france gets an NAP with italy and more is not needed because it'll result the same in the opening...
i don't think it'll become a 3-way draw if the alliance is succesful because then they can still take out 1 of the 3...
it'll give austria more chance because he can hold strong against the juggernaut with italy, and that's his biggest worry at the beginning...
so what do you guys think??
spyman (424 D(G))
12 Feb 11 UTC
I would imagine that would work best if France is planning to attack England with help from Germany. If France aligns with England he will probably end up moving into a Med game once Germany is defeated.
However once England is gone, and Austria and Italy have defeated Turkey and Russia, where will Italy go?

airborne (154 D)
12 Feb 11 UTC
Traditional I would play for a F/G/A rather than a F/G/I (unless I'm Italy!) because of the ease of the alliance. France will end up with the western half of the board. Austria can't really challenge France in the Med and will take the southeast board. Finally Germany has basically the rest of board. Also France and Germany can make pretty good agreement on DMZ at Bur/Ruh/Hol/Bel. Again Austria and France can't really go at it becuase of Austrian lack of fleets and Piedmont. Germany and Austria should never come to blows (Richard Sharps Game of Diplomacy)
